Aims, contents and method of the course
In this class the central areas of linguistics will be presented. Emphasis is laid on the introduction of basic concepts, theses and models of phonology and morphology. In practical exercises students will discover important analytical methods of linguistics.This class is obligatory in the first semester and a prerequisite for all further classes.

Assessment and permitted materials
Homework, participation in class, written final examination
Minimum requirements and assessment criteria
The final mark consists of 3 parts: homework, participation in discussion, and a written final exam.
Examination topics
Analysis of datasets that students should not be familiar with. Any written material may be used, but no electronic media.
